Compare Hamilton to Toledo

This post compares Hamilton, Ohio to Toledo, Ohio across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.

Dimension Hamilton (city) Toledo (city)
Population 62,216 279,455
Income (median) $39,761 $37,754
Home Value (median) $102,300 $78,600
White 84% 63%
Black 9% 27%
Asian 0% 1%
With Kids 31% 29%
Age (median) 37 35
Rentals 43% 48%
